    The “M” on the back window denotes that the driver is a learner for the public highway and doesn’t have a full driving licence....that learner driver Oliver Solberg went fastest in qualifying for Rally Liepāja today.

    The kid is fast !

    Solberg with a Latvian licence ?
    Wiki:
    "Due to his young age, Solberg runs a Latvian license. Latvia has a lower age limit than Norway for both rally and rallycross , while in Sweden it is possible to run rally from 16 years but not in similar motor-strong cars as it is allowed in Latvia."

    Plus I didnt realise he had done much of his rallying in Latvia. Might explain this speed here.

    He started in Latvia age 15, its 16 yrs in both Norway and sweden, but in cars like R1 and Fiesta ST, he has driven a Peugeot R2 in Latvia last years.
    But in Norway the codriver has to drive the car between the stages, don't know how it is in Latvia?

    But a quite decent start by Oliver, 3,5s in front of Brynhildsen that was on "maximum attack ".
    Hopefully he has an other gear to put in this weekend.
